Output 3c4ac6f1237a28af0379b6f725b63ded7e09bd20f90a34b7532d14ce3a4bc23f:4

value
170787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a034b143feca679add9932bde542f9a1adec2a OP_EQUAL
address
39DuFa1uYq318dnMCVFrtGxDwkiCMQawNE
transaction
3c4ac6f1237a28af0379b6f725b63ded7e09bd20f90a34b7532d14ce3a4bc23f
confirmations
426659
spent
true